Transaction e1460c89053aed8ebf888f1b8ec26382360c1e9c2d9c24da67b5b67d68f42977
1 Input
1 Output
-
e1460c89053aed8ebf888f1b8ec26382360c1e9c2d9c24da67b5b67d68f42977:0
- value
- 10621750
- script pubkey
- OP_0 OP_PUSHBYTES_20 343940348402f43a47a866eb82af3809ca31d71f
- address
- bc1qxsu5qdyyqt6r53agvm4c9tecp89rr4clvukkg4